Why Homeowners Start With a Block Wall Repair Plan

A damaged boundary wall or cinder block structure rarely stays “cosmetic” for long. Small cracks can allow moisture intrusion, freeze-thaw cycles, and shifting soil to widen defects over time. When a wall begins to tilt or Block wall repair Glendale bow, the issue becomes both a safety concern and a long-term durability problem. Finding a dependable local partner early helps protect the property, landscaping, and nearby structures from progressive deterioration.

Many homeowners first notice the problem after heavy rain, seasonal landscaping changes, or impacts from vehicles and debris. Even when the surface looks intact, mortar loss and internal displacement can be developing within the block cores. A clear repair plan starts with identifying the failure pattern, since different causes call for different fixes. That discovery process is where expert inspection sets the foundation for stable results and a more predictable total cost.

What to Expect From Expert Assessment and Damage Diagnosis

Professional block wall repair begins with a careful walkthrough, including visual inspection and close evaluation of mortar condition, alignment, and crack behavior. Inspectors look for signs of settlement such as uneven footing support, bulging blocks, and stair-step cracking bowing brick wall repair cost in masonry joints. They also assess drainage around the wall, because poor water control can keep feeding the problem. Taking notes and documenting the wall’s condition supports transparent recommendations rather than guesswork.

When bowing or leaning is present, the underlying cause might involve a failing foundation, inadequate reinforcement, or shifting backfill. In these cases, repair can require more than patching mortar; it may involve stabilizing the wall, addressing voids, and rebuilding affected sections. A reputable team can explain the repair approach in plain language, including what will be removed, what will be rebuilt, and how the wall will be brought back toward proper alignment. This clarity helps property owners understand the scope and make confident decisions.

Repair Approaches and How Professionals Weigh Bowing Wall Pricing

Repair methods vary based on how far the wall has moved and how extensive the damage is. Some situations benefit from targeted block replacement and repointing, while others require partial or full section rebuilding. If voids exist behind the wall, restoring structural stability may include correcting backfill conditions and improving drainage pathways. The goal is to rebuild strength, not simply cover imperfections so the wall can perform reliably again.

Costs depend on factors such as wall length, the height of the affected area, severity of bowing, and the need for reinforcement or underpinning. Additional considerations include whether blocks or bricks are damaged beyond repair, whether special mortar matching is required, and the complexity of access around the wall. By breaking the work into clear components, an expert contractor can provide a more accurate estimate tied to the real condition of the structure.
